1932 De Havilland D.H.84 Dragon fitted with two 130hp D. H. Gipsy Major engines was conceived as a twin-engine equivalent of the Fox Moth. This six passenger aircraft was ordered by Hillman Airways to be used on their service to Paris. One hundred and fifteen were built in Britain, with a further 87 built in Australia, and were used extensively by the airlines of the 1930s. This one is pictured on a survey flight over the Shetland Islands in June 1933; a few survive today.
Sumbergh Head Lighthouse, Shetland. June 1933
